Subject: Quickstore 4.2 — bloom filter now fronts the KV layer

Plugin authors: starting with this release, Quickstore places a bloom filter ahead of the key-value store. Negative lookups return faster; false positives fall through safely. No API changes are required on your side. Verify your plugin against the staging build referenced below.

session token of fahif-tadup = htk3_9c7

Subject: Crash-report pipeline — quick intro for new folks

Hey all! If you're new to the Pebbleworth mobile team, welcome. Our crash reports from the Lumen app flow through the Sifter pipeline: device uploads land in the intake queue, get symbolicated, then bucketed by signature before hitting the dashboard. Most of the time it just works. If a release looks noisy, check the intake lag graph before panicking. Every announcement here includes the build token for the cut, which you'll find right below.

pipeline stamp: htk6_7941f2

Subject: On-call intro — firmware channel

Hi, welcome to the Fenlock rotation. You'll cover the device-firmware update channel for the Ostrell sensor fleet. Key points: promotions go staging → canary → broad, never skip canary; rollbacks are automatic if failure rate tops 2%. Most pages are stuck canary gates — usually safe to hold, not roll. Don't promote manually without a second approver. The full escalation procedure is on the internal page.

runbook for badug-kadup: https://confluence.zemvarlabs.internal/projects/browse/display/projects/bd1b

Runbook: dependency pinning for the Mosswick platform. All services pin exact versions; ranges are forbidden in manifests. Reviewers should block any change that updates a pin without a linked advisory or changelog note. Transitive bumps go through the Latchkey resolver, which regenerates the lockfile weekly — never edit it by hand. Emergency unpins require two approvals and expire after seven days. The resolver enforces these rules via its service config, reproduced below for review.

service settings:
PRAIX_LOG_LEVEL=error
PRAIX_METRICS_HOST=metrics.praix.qorvelcorp.corp
PRAIX_POOL_SIZE=16